OpenJDK 18 ganha servidor Web simples e UTF-8 por padrão

OpenJDK 18 ganha servidor Web simples e UTF-8 por padrão
OpenJDK 18 ganha servidor Web simples e UTF-8 por padrão

A Oracle anunciou a disponibilidade geral do JDK/OpenJDK 18 como a implementação de referência do Java 18. O OpenJDK 18 está agora pronto para uso em produção e inclui vários novos recursos junto com “centenas de melhorias menores e mais de mil correções de bugs”. Um dos destaques principais com o OpenJDK 18 é que o UTF-8 é finalmente o conjunto de caracteres padrão para APIs Java SE. 

Esta atualização também inclui o trabalho mais recente na API de vetor do Java que, em tempo de execução, permite usar o uso ideal de instruções de vetor para um determinado processador, como AVX ou NEON.

Esta página fornece compilações de código aberto prontas para produção do Java Development Kit, versão 18, uma implementação da Plataforma Java SE 18 sob a GNU General Public License, versão 2, com a exceção Classpath.

Construções comerciais do JDK 18 da Oracle, sob uma licença não-open-source, podem ser encontradas na Oracle Technology Network.

OpenJDK 18 ganha servidor Web simples e UTF-8 por padrão

OpenJDK 18 ganha servidor Web simples e UTF-8 por padrão

Outra adição notável com o OpenJDK 18 é incluir um servidor web simples como parte do pacote. Jwebserver é uma nova ferramenta de linha de comando para iniciar um servidor web estático mínimo baseado em Java que está incluído como parte do JDK.

O OpenJDK 18 também adiciona suporte ao heap do coletor de lixo G1 para regiões de até 512 MB e uma variedade de outras adições e melhorias.

Versões

Linux / AArch64tar.gz (sha256)186983593 bytes
Linux/x64tar.gz (sha256)188173501 bytes
macOS/AArch64tar.gz (sha256)183221810 bytes
macOS/x64tar.gz (sha256)185375922 bytes
Windows/x64zip (sha256)187504061 bytes

Notas

  • A versão do Alpine Linux disponível anteriormente nesta página foi removida a partir do primeiro candidato a lançamento do JDK 18. Não está pronto para produção porque não foi testado o suficiente para ser considerado uma compilação GA. Por favor, use a compilação JDK 19 Alpine Linux de acesso antecipado em seu lugar.
  • Se você tiver dificuldade para baixar qualquer um desses arquivos, entre em contato com jdk-download-help_ww@oracle.com.

Se você tiver sugestões ou encontrar bugs, envie-as usando o canal de relatório de bugs Java SE usual. Certifique-se de incluir informações completas sobre a versão da saída do java --version comando.

Restrições de uso internacional

Devido à proteção e aplicação limitadas da propriedade intelectual em alguns países, o código-fonte só pode ser distribuído para uma lista autorizada de países. Você não poderá acessar o código-fonte se estiver baixando de um país que não está nesta lista. Estamos continuamente revisando esta lista para adição de outros países.

Downloads e mais detalhes sobre a versão de agora do JDK 18 GA via jdk.java.net.

Acesse a versão completa
Sair da versão mobile